The Indosat BlackBerry Community represents all BlackBerry users in Indonesia that share the same carrier – Indosat. There are 6 million BlackBerry users in Indonesia (and counting). 140 million iOS users are sending 1 billion iMessages every day

I wanted to document this one from yesterday’s WWDC keynote. I’ve been looking out for some statistics from Apple about the adoption of iMessage. 140 million iMessage users is a highly impressive number in itself, given the platform only launched last year.
